当前位置: 首页 > news >正文

R-CNN、Fast R-CNN和Faster R-CNN:目标检测的进化之路

在计算机视觉的世界里,目标检测是一个重要的任务,它的目标是找到图像中的特定物体,并标注出它们的位置。这项技术广泛应用于自动驾驶、安防监控等领域。为了让计算机能够准确高效地完成这一任务,科学家们提出了许多优秀的算法,其中最具代表性的就是R-CNN、Fast R-CNN和Faster R-CNN。这三者的进化过程,展示了目标检测技术的不断进步与突破。

1. R-CNN:目标检测的初步探索

R-CNN(Region-based Convolutional Neural Network) 是由Ross Girshick等人在2014年提出的一种目标检测算法,它开创性地将卷积神经网络(CNN)引入到目标检测任务中。R-CNN的核心思想是:先从图像中提取出一系列候选区域(Region Proposals),然后对这些区域分别进行分类和位置调整。

R-CNN的工作流程如下:

  1. 候选区域生成:使用选择性搜索(Selective Search)算法,从图像中生成大约2000个候选区域。
  2. 特征提取:将每个候选区域调整为固定大小(例如227x227),然后通过预训练的卷积神经网络提取特征。
  3. 分类与回归:使用支持向量机(SVM)对提取的特征进行分类,并使用回归模型调整候选区域的边界框位置。

虽然R-CNN显著提高了目标检测的准确性,但其计算效率较低,因为每个候选区域都需要单独通过卷积神经网络进行特征提取。

相关文章:

  • 北京网站建设多少钱?
  • 辽宁网页制作哪家好_网站建设
  • 高端品牌网站建设_汉中网站制作
  • 什么叫图像的双边滤波,并附利用OpenCV和MATLB实现双边滤波的代码
  • 爬虫管理:开启企业大数据时代的智能信息搜集
  • 2024全球和国内最常用的弱密码,有没有你的?
  • vue3 + antd + typeScript 封装一个高仿的ProTable(2)
  • 关于Kafka的17个问题
  • .Net Core中的内存缓存实现——Redis及MemoryCache(2个可选)方案的实现
  • 请你谈谈:spring bean的生命周期 - 阶段2:Bean实例化阶段
  • 【PostgreSQL】PostgreSQL 教程
  • 【python虚拟环境管理】【mac m3】 使用pipx安装poetry
  • ASP.NET第七章 --案例1
  • 关闭Ubuntu烦人的apport
  • rust编译安卓各个平台so库
  • 艺术与技术的交响曲:CSS绘图的艺术与实践
  • linux搭建mysql主从复制(一主一从)
  • Autosar RTE配置-Assembly和Delegation的使用-基于ETAS软件
  • 【跃迁之路】【444天】程序员高效学习方法论探索系列(实验阶段201-2018.04.25)...
  • CODING 缺陷管理功能正式开始公测
  • JAVA SE 6 GC调优笔记
  • Logstash 参考指南(目录)
  • Making An Indicator With Pure CSS
  • 翻译:Hystrix - How To Use
  • 简单易用的leetcode开发测试工具(npm)
  • 面试遇到的一些题
  • 硬币翻转问题,区间操作
  • d²y/dx²; 偏导数问题 请问f1 f2是什么意思
  • 【干货分享】dos命令大全
  • Hibernate主键生成策略及选择
  • ​ 全球云科技基础设施:亚马逊云科技的海外服务器网络如何演进
  • ​数据链路层——流量控制可靠传输机制 ​
  • #### golang中【堆】的使用及底层 ####
  • #调用传感器数据_Flink使用函数之监控传感器温度上升提醒
  • (附源码)springboot美食分享系统 毕业设计 612231
  • (附源码)ssm教师工作量核算统计系统 毕业设计 162307
  • (四)TensorRT | 基于 GPU 端的 Python 推理
  • (译) 理解 Elixir 中的宏 Macro, 第四部分:深入化
  • (原創) 如何讓IE7按第二次Ctrl + Tab時,回到原來的索引標籤? (Web) (IE) (OS) (Windows)...
  • (转)C#开发微信门户及应用(1)--开始使用微信接口
  • **《Linux/Unix系统编程手册》读书笔记24章**
  • *算法训练(leetcode)第四十天 | 647. 回文子串、516. 最长回文子序列
  • .Net 6.0--通用帮助类--FileHelper
  • .NET MVC 验证码
  • .NET企业级应用架构设计系列之开场白
  • .NET中的十进制浮点类型,徐汇区网站设计
  • @antv/g6 业务场景:流程图
  • @RequestMapping 的作用是什么?
  • [ 英语 ] 马斯克抱水槽“入主”推特总部中那句 Let that sink in 到底是什么梗?
  • [Android] Upload package to device fails #2720
  • [Android]通过PhoneLookup读取所有电话号码
  • [Bzoj4722]由乃(线段树好题)(倍增处理模数小快速幂)
  • [C#学习笔记]LINQ
  • [C/C++]数据结构 循环队列
  • [c++] 单例模式 + cyberrt TimingWheel 单例分析
  • [CCF-CSP] 202303-4 星际网络II
  • [C语言]一维数组二维数组的大小
  • [FFmpeg] windows下安装带gpu加速的ffmpeg